About the role

What is the opportunity?

In this role, you will be a key member of the Banking & Payments Team with P&L responsibility for the debit cards portfolio. You will need to balance business priorities, client experience as well as risk exposure through effective oversight of product policies and procedures. You will also lead and support strategic initiatives designed to achieve business goals and ensure compliance with internal standards and Interac requirements. Daily responsibilities include managing P&L performance, overseeing client and advisor escalations, and supporting key partnerships, enterprise-wide programs, and Interac mandates.

Royal Bank of Canada is a global financial institution with a purpose-driven, principles-led approach to delivering leading performance. Our success comes from the 94,000+ employees who leverage their imaginations and insights to bring our vision, values and strategy to life so we can help our clients thrive and communities prosper. As Canada's biggest bank and one of the largest in the world, based on market capitalization, we have a diversified business model with a focus on innovation and providing exceptional experiences to our more than 17 million clients in Canada, the U.S. and 27 other countries.
